JAY: FAILURE DRIVES US ON

Posted on: Fri 25 Sep 2009

Jay Bothroyd has revealed that last season's dramatic last-day failure to get into the play-offs is driving Cardiff City's players on to promotion this time round.

The Bluebirds striker was speaking ahead of the visit to Hillsborough, where Sheffield Wednesday won 1-0 to bury City's hopes last May.

Jay said: "We have unfinished business there. We want to put it right this time. I was gutted that day, although it didn't really hit me until I got home. Our last four games let us down when we had been expecting to get into the play-offs and go even further.

"It's on your mind a lot of the time. I'm not just talking about what happened at Wednesday and the 6-0 defeat at Preston. You look back and think what if we hadn't let in late equalisers at places like Blackpool and Birmingham? It''s driving us on."

Jay netted in time added on in the Carling Cup tie at Aston Villa in midweek, only to be thwarted by an incorrect offside decision.

He said: "The tape clearly showed the goal was onside. As much as Villa dominated us at times, we dominated them. We put in a lacklustre performance against QPR, but gave a good account of ourselves against Villa. I felt comfortable on my own up front in a 4-5-1, although I really prefer playing 4-4-2."
